Notes: This is also known as “Bambi, Style One.” Large Bambi was listed on the Fall 1956 order form in a column titled, “Disney Line,” which was distinguished from the “Disney Miniatures.” The line drawing for Large Bambi was used for Miniature Bambi from F1957-S1960.
The comparison photo illustrates the size difference between Large Bambi and the Miniature Bambi with Butterfly.

Notes: The butterfly was a separately molded piece which may become detached over time. All the order forms specifically mention the butterfly except for Spring 1960. It’s not clear if Bambi was sold with or without the butterfly for that season.

Notes: The comparison photo shows color and detail variations of Bambi.
The same mold was used for both Faline and Small Bambi; the caramel Bambi coloration is harder to find despite having apparently been produced much longer. The mold is also known as “Bambi, Style Two.”
This mold was later reissued as a Miniature, A-875, with different colors and detail. Only pieces which closely resemble the photo here are Disney issues. Miniature reissues of Disney pieces are called Non-Disneys by collectors.
